On December 5 and 6, Kaluga Region hosted a delegation from the Japanese Association for Trade with Russia and Newly Independent States (ROTOBO), headed by the association’s Director Kunio Okada.
At the meeting with Governor Anatoly Artamonov, Kunio Okada gave a positive assessment to the dynamic development of the automobile industry in Russia. “Kaluga’s development model has become an example of successful economic cooperation between countries for us. We refer to Kaluga Region’s experience when building relations with Russian regions”, said Kunio Okada.
During their stay in Kaluga Region, the Japanese delegation will visit several enterprises, including KADVI JSC, where Italian company Gervasi recently launched production, Gestamp-Severstal-Kaluga LLC and PSMA Rus LLC.
ROTOBO has nearly 200 members, including trade companies, enterprises from various industry segments, banks, securities firms, industry associations, passenger and cargo transportation agencies and local governance agencies.
